Description
Triumph Pre Unit Timing Cover Bush
Part# 70-0378, E378
Made in England
$20.00
Triumph Pre Unit Timing Cover Bush
Part# 70-0378, E378
Made in England
2 in stock!
Triumph Pre Unit Timing Cover Bush
Part# 70-0378, E378
Made in England
2 in stock!
More than 10 in stock!
More than 10 in stock!
3 in stock!